Tom Allen is Clemson’s new defensive coordinator. Coach Dabo Swinney and the Tigers have their new DC in place after the Clemson University Board of Trustees compensation committee unanimously ...
Penn State defensive coordinator Tom Allen is reportedly leaving the Nittany Lions program to coach at Clemson. The news was first reported by ESPN’s Pete Thamel, who says ...
Allen replaced Manny Diaz as Penn State's defensive coordinator after Diaz became the head coach at Duke. PSU’s defense was one of the best in college football in 2024 and allowed as many yards per ...